I made a flock of sheep using Stampin' Up punches!  I will connect the Easter treats shown in the picture to the backs of the sheep using Snail Tape.

Here's the list of punches I used:
  • Body: Scallop Circle
  • Head: Owl Builder (the body with the legs cut off)
  • Tuft of Wool on the Head: Boho Blossom
  • Eyes: Owl Builder (white section is the largest circle & black section is the middle size circle)
  • Tongue: Owl Builder (same as the black section of eye but cut in half)
  • Legs: Word Window (cut in half)
